What is a Key Fob?

A key fob is a handheld device that is used to manage keyless entry systems in lorries. Key fobs can also include additional functions, such as the capability to start the engine from another location, activate the trunk release, and set the security alarm. They operate utilizing radio frequency identification (RFID) innovation, depending on signals sent out in between the fob and the car's onboard computer system.

Typical Reasons for Key Fob Replacement

  1. Loss or Theft: Key fobs are small and can be easily lost or taken.
  2. Battery Depletion: Over time, the battery in a key fob can wear down, affecting its functionality.
  3. Physical Damages: Dropping the fob or direct exposure to water can cause irreversible damage.
  4. Technical Malfunctions: Sometimes, a key fob can stop working to interact with the vehicle due to internal malfunctioning.

How to Replace a Key Fob

Changing a key fob can vary based on the kind of vehicle and key fob itself, but here are general steps you can follow:

1. Determine the Type of Key Fob

Before proceeding with replacement, it is vital to determine the kind of key fob you have. There are typically 2 classifications:

  • smart replacement car keys Key Fobs: Used in advanced keyless entry systems that permit proximity unlocking.
  • Traditional Key Fobs: Commonly utilized for locking/unlocking and beginning lorries.

2. Inspect Warranty or Insurance

Before purchasing a new key fob, check if your vehicle is still under service warranty. In some cases, dealerships might replace a malfunctioning fob at no charge. Additionally, if you have insurance, inquire whether lost or stolen keys are covered.

3. Purchase a Replacement

There are several alternatives available for acquiring a replacement key fob:

  • Dealership: Visiting the car maker's dealer is often the most uncomplicated method, although it can be the most pricey.
  • Automotive Locksmith: A competent locksmith can typically set a new fob at a lower cost than a dealership.
  • Online Retailers: Websites selling O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er) parts often offer less expensive alternatives, however programming may be needed afterward.
SourceCost EstimateProgramming Needed
Dealer₤ 100 - ₤ 600Yes
Automotive Locksmith₤ 50 - ₤ 200Yes
Online Retailers₤ 20 - ₤ 100 (fob only)Yes

4. Program the New Fob

Programming the fob can be done either by following manual directions supplied with the brand-new fob or, sometimes, requiring an expert service to do it. Configuring actions can typically consist of:

  • Accessing the Vehicle: Depending on the fob type, you may require to use an existing key or go through a particular series to enter shows mode.
  • Synchronization: Hold down the appropriate buttons on the new fob to sync it with your vehicle.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. The length of time does a key fob last?

Usually, a key fob can last in between 3 to 5 years, depending upon use and battery life. However, battery replacement can typically extend its life expectancy.

2. Can I program a key fob myself?

Lots of key fobs can be configured in the house by following actions described in your vehicle's user handbook. However, more complex systems might require dealership intervention.

3. What should I do if my key fob stops working unexpectedly?

First, try replacing the battery of the fob. If that does not work, guarantee that there is no signal interference and examine the fob for any physical damages. If concerns continue, speak with an expert.

4. Is a key fob replacement covered under insurance coverage?

This varies widely by service provider and policy, so it's best to contact your insurance business for specific protection choices relating to lost or taken key fobs.

5. Are there alternative keyless entry options?

Yes, many cars today come equipped with mobile phone app options or biometrics like fingerprint scanners for entry and vehicle start.

Tips for Maintaining Your Key Fob

To extend the life of your key fob and avoid future replacements, consider the following upkeep suggestions:

  • Store it Safely: Always put your fob in a designated place to prevent loss.
  • Prevent Water Exposure: Keep your fob dry and away from water to avoid electronic damage.
  • Battery Changes: Replace the battery when you see a decline in efficiency, such as a lower variety or failure to unlock the car.
  • Regular Checks: Periodically inspect the fob for physical wear and tear.
